Your x-intercept will have a coordinate of (4.333,0). The key here is to rearrange your equation to slop-intercept form: y = mx + b.

So, y + 1 = 3(x-4) -> y = 3(x-4)-1 and with expanding you’ll get y= 3x-13.

To find your x-intercept, simply set y = 0 and factor: 0 = 3(x-13/3). The value that sets your equation to zero is your x-intercept, therefore the answer is 13/3. The coordinate for that would be (4.333,0).

Your y-intercept is the b value in your y = mx + b, therefore the answer is -13. The coordinate for that would be (0,-13).
